The bode magnitude plot for the transfer function  V 0 ( s ) V i ( s ) of the circuit is as shown. The value of R is ______ Ω. (Round off to 2 decimal places.)

Solution :

The correct answer is 0.1.

1. Analysis of the Circuit:
The given circuit is a series RLC low-pass filter with:
Inductance, L = 1 mH = 1 × 10-3 H
Capacitance, C = 250 µF = 250 × 10-6 F
The output voltage V0(s) is measured across the capacitor C.

The transfer function of the series RLC circuit is given by:
H ( s ) = V 0 ( s ) V i ( s ) = 1 C s R + L s + 1 C s = 1 L C s 2 + R C s + 1

Rewriting this in standard second-order system form:
H ( s ) = ω n 2 s 2 + 2 ζ ω n s + ω n 2
where:
ω n = 1 L C
and the damping ratio ζ is:
ζ = R 2 C L

2. Finding the Damping Ratio (ζ) from the Bode Plot:
From the given Bode magnitude plot, we observe that the resonant peak is at ω = 2000 rad/s, and the peak magnitude height is 26 dB.

The resonant peak value Mr (in linear scale) is related to the peak magnitude in dB by:
20 log 10 ( M r ) = 26
M r = 10 26 / 20 = 10 1.3 19.95

The standard formula for the resonant peak magnitude Mr of a second-order system is:
M r = 1 2 ζ 1 ζ 2
Substituting Mr = 19.95:
2 ζ 1 ζ 2 = 1 19.95 0.050125
Since ζ is very small, we can approximate 1 - ζ2 ≈ 1, which gives:
2 ζ 0.05 ζ 0.025

3. Calculating the Resistance R:
Using the damping ratio formula for the series RLC circuit:
ζ = R 2 C L
Substituting the values of ζ, C, and L:
0.025 = R 2 250 × 10 6 1 × 10 3
0.025 = R 2 0.25
0.025 = R 2 × 0.5
0.025 = 0.25 R
R = 0.025 0.25 = 0.1 Ω
